City Of Des Moines: Des Moines And Energy Leaders Launch 24/7 Carbon-Free Energy Compact
The Compact represents a new global effort to accelerate the transition to a carbon-free electricity sector.
September 24, 2021
NEW YORK, - Leading energy buyers, suppliers, solutions providers and governments announced today the formal launch of the 24/7 Carbon-free Energy Compact in partnership with Sustainable Energy for All and the UN Energy. The Compact represents a new global effort to accelerate the transition to a carbon-free electricity sector to mitigate the worst impacts of climate change. SEforALL and Google made the announcement today during the United Nations High level Dialogue on Energy in New York. In addition to Google, founding signatories of the Compact include The AES Corporation, Orsted, EDP, the city of Des Moines, Iowa, the government of Iceland, and others.
